Subject: [PATCH 4.19 47/95] ARM: uaccess: consolidate uaccess asm to asm/uaccess-asm.h
Date: Mon,  1 Jun 2020 19:53:47 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200601174028.239653484@linuxfoundation.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200601174020.759151073@linuxfoundation.org>

From: Russell King <rmk+kernel@armlinux.org.uk>

[ Upstream commit 747ffc2fcf969eff9309d7f2d1d61cb8b9e1bb40 ]

Consolidate the user access assembly code to asm/uaccess-asm.h.  This
moves the csdb, check_uaccess, uaccess_mask_range_ptr, uaccess_enable,
uaccess_disable, uaccess_save, uaccess_restore macros, and creates two
new ones for exception entry and exit - uaccess_entry and uaccess_exit.

This makes the uaccess_save and uaccess_restore macros private to
asm/uaccess-asm.h.

diff --git a/arch/arm/include/asm/uaccess-asm.h b/arch/arm/include/asm/uaccess-asm.h
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..d475e3e8145d
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/arm/include/asm/uaccess-asm.h
@@ -0,0 +1,106 @@
+/*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-only */
+
+#ifndef __ASM_UACCESS_ASM_H__
+#define __ASM_UACCESS_ASM_H__
+
+#include <asm/asm-offsets.h>
+#include <asm/domain.h>
+#include <asm/memory.h>
+#include <asm/thread_info.h>
+
+	.macro	csdb
+#ifdef CONFIG_THUMB2_KERNEL
+	.inst.w	0xf3af8014
+#else
+	.inst	0xe320f014
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ro check_uaccess, addr:req, size:req, limit:req, tmp:req, bad:req
+#ifndef CONFIG_CPU_USE_DOMAINS
+	adds	\tmp, \addr, #\size - 1
+	sbcscc	\tmp, \tmp, \limit
+	bcs	\bad
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SPECTRE
+	movcs	\addr, #0
+	csdb
+#endif
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ro uaccess_mask_range_ptr, addr:req, size:req, limit:req, tmp:req
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SPECTRE
+	sub	\tmp, \limit, #1
+	subs	\tmp, \tmp, \addr	@ tmp = limit - 1 - addr
+	addhs	\tmp, \tmp, #1		@ if (tmp >= 0) {
+	subshs	\tmp, \tmp, \size	@ tmp = limit - (addr + size) }
+	movlo	\addr, #0		@ if (tmp < 0) addr = NULL
+	csdb
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ro	uaccess_disable, tmp, isb=1
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SW_DOMAIN_PAN
+	/*
+	 * Whenever we re-enter userspace, the domains should always be
+	 * set appropriately.
+	 */
+	mov	\tmp, #DACR_UACCESS_DISABLE
+	mcr	p15, 0, \tmp, c3, c0, 0		@ Set domain register
+	.if	\isb
+	instr_sync
+	.endif
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ro	uaccess_enable, tmp, isb=1
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SW_DOMAIN_PAN
+	/*
+	 * Whenever we re-enter userspace, the domains should always be
+	 * set appropriately.
+	 */
+	mov	\tmp, #DACR_UACCESS_ENABLE
+	mcr	p15, 0, \tmp, c3, c0, 0
+	.if	\isb
+	instr_sync
+	.endif
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ro	uaccess_save, tmp
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SW_DOMAIN_PAN
+	mrc	p15, 0, \tmp, c3, c0, 0
+	str	\tmp, [sp, #SVC_DACR]
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	.macro	uaccess_restore
+#ifdef CONFIG_CPU_SW_DOMAIN_PAN
+	ldr	r0, [sp, #SVC_DACR]
+	mcr	p15, 0, r0, c3, c0, 0
+#endif
+	.endm
+
+	/*
+	 * Save the address limit on entry to a privileged exception and
+	 * if using PAN, save and disable usermode access.
+	 */
+	.macro	uaccess_entry, tsk, tmp0, tmp1, tmp2, disable
+	ldr	\tmp0, [\tsk, #TI_ADDR_LIMIT]
+	mov	\tmp1, #TASK_SIZE
+	str	\tmp1, [\tsk, #TI_ADDR_LIMIT]
+	str	\tmp0, [sp, #SVC_ADDR_LIMIT]
+	uaccess_save \tmp0
+	.if \disable
+	uaccess_disable \tmp0
+	.endif
+	.endm
+
+	/* Restore the user access state previously saved by uaccess_entry */
+	.macro	uaccess_exit, tsk, tmp0, tmp1
+	ldr	\tmp1, [sp, #SVC_ADDR_LIMIT]
+	uaccess_restore
+	str	\tmp1, [\tsk, #TI_ADDR_LIMIT]
+	.endm
+
+#endif /* __ASM_UACCESS_ASM_H__ */
